1410, 17ac, WHERE REMOTE CONTROL OF PROPULSION MACHINERY FROM THE NAVIGATION BRIDGE IS PROVIDED AND THE MACHINERY SPACES ARE INTENDED TO BE MANNED, THE FOLLOWING SHALL APPLY: THE SPEED, DIRECTION OF THRUST AND , IF APPLICABLE, THE PITCH OF THE PROPELLER SHALL BE FULLY CONTROLABLE FROM THE NAVIGATION BRIDGE UNDER ALL SAILING CONDITIONS, INCLUDING MANOEUVRING. VESSEL'S CONTROLS OF THE MAIN ENGINE FROM THE NAVIGATION BRIDGE ARE INOPERABLE. VESSEL IS ONLY ABLE TO CONTROL THE SPEED AND DIRECTION OF THRUST FROM THE MAIN ENGINE LOCALLY. SOLAS '74 (2014 CONS.) II-1/31.2.1
Action required: 17 - Rectify deficiencies prior to departure
Resolved 19 November 2017
Resolution: PSC received satisfactory class report attesting to the proper operation of bridge controls.
